Wildflower Report for McNeil Point

LocationMcNeil Point
Date06/27/2023
ReporterGreg Lief

CommentsErhan Cross encountered some patches of snow along the trail, which makes sense because it is still early. However, he also saw some early beargrass blooms, lots of avalanche lilies, paintbrush, lupines, western columbine, shooting stars, larkspur, and much more. See his photos in the OW Facebook group.
